Job Description:

Assist in designing and conducting experiments focused on optimizing piezoelectric design and manufacturing via electromechanical systems.Participate in the development and testing of prototypes, applying principles of electromechanical engineering to improve product performance.Support the analysis of experimental data, utilizing engineering principles to interpret results and suggest improvements.Contribute to the maintenance and operation of specialized manufacturing and testing equipment.Collaborate with a multidisciplinary team of engineers and scientists to solve complex challenges related to piezoelectric technology.Prepare and present reports and presentations to share findings and progress with the team and broader scientific community.

Requirements/Qualifications:

Currently pursuing a bachelor's degree in Electromechanical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, Electrical Engineering, or a closely related field.Demonstrated interest in the interface of materials science and electromechanical systems, particularly in piezoelectric technology.Basic proficiency in the use of CAD software and familiarity with electromechanical simulation tools.Ability to analyze and interpret complex data, with proficiency in relevant software tools (e.g., MATLAB, LabVIEW).Strong problem-solving skills, attention to detail, and the capacity to work on multifaceted projects.Excellent communication skills, capable of effectively presenting technical information.

Ability to work both independently and as part of a team.Effective communication skills, with the ability to present complex information clearly and concisely.Proficient in the use of Microsoft Office software (Excel, PowerPoint, Word).US Citizenship Required
